Monochromatic light is incident on a glass prism of angle A. If the refractive index of the material oft the prism is μ, a ray incident at an angle θ, on the face AB would get transmitted through the face AC of the prism provided

  • straight theta space greater than space sin to the power of negative 1 end exponent open square brackets straight mu space sin space open parentheses straight A minus sin to the power of negative 1 end exponent open parentheses 1 over straight mu close parentheses close parentheses close square brackets
  • straight theta space less than space sin to the power of negative 1 end exponent open square brackets straight mu space sin space open parentheses straight A minus sin to the power of negative 1 end exponent open parentheses 1 over straight mu close parentheses close parentheses close square brackets
  • straight theta less than cos to the power of negative 1 end exponent open square brackets straight mu space sin space open parentheses straight A minus sin to the power of negative 1 end exponent open parentheses 1 over straight mu close parentheses close parentheses close square brackets
  • straight theta space greater than cos to the power of negative 1 end exponent open square brackets straight mu space sin space open parentheses straight A minus sin to the power of negative 1 end exponent open parentheses 1 over straight mu close parentheses close parentheses close square brackets

Solution

A.

straight theta space greater than space sin to the power of negative 1 end exponent open square brackets straight mu space sin space open parentheses straight A minus sin to the power of negative 1 end exponent open parentheses 1 over straight mu close parentheses close parentheses close square brackets

The Ray will get transmitted through face AC if iAC < iC
Consider the ray diagram is shown below θ.

A ray of light incident on face AB at angle 
r1 = Angle of refraction on face AB
r2 = Angle of incidence at face AC
For transmission of light through face AC
iAC < iC or A-ri < iC
 or Sin (A-r1)1)< 1/μ
straight A minus straight r subscript 1 space less than space sin to the power of negative 1 end exponent space open parentheses 1 over straight mu close parentheses
sin space straight r subscript 1 space greater than space sin space open square brackets straight A minus sin to the power of negative 1 end exponent open parentheses 1 over straight mu close parentheses close square brackets
Now, applying snell's law at the face AB
1 x sin θ = μ sin r1 or sinr1 = sinθ/μ
fraction numerator sin space straight theta over denominator straight mu end fraction space greater than space sin space open square brackets straight A minus sin to the power of negative 1 end exponent open parentheses 1 over straight mu close parentheses close square brackets
straight theta greater than space sin to the power of negative 1 end exponent open square brackets straight mu space sin space open curly brackets straight A space minus space sin to the power of negative 1 end exponent open parentheses 1 over straight mu close parentheses close curly brackets close square brackets
